✓ best Jan-FebThe sweet-spot windows
Good weather, thinner crowds, better prices: the windows worth aiming for.
| Where | When | Why it works | Watch out for |
|---|---|---|---|
| Andes | Dec-Feb, Jul-Aug | The two drier windows. Bogota/Medellin mild year-round | Apr-May, Oct-Nov wet |
| Caribbean | Dec-Apr | Dry season: calm clear sea, sunny. Cartagena at its best | Oct wettest |
